Baseball Goes Undefeated in Final Series
DOYLESTOWN, Pa. – The Aggies finished their season today against King’s college, ending the day undefeated over the two ties. Game 1: Delaware Valley 23 – King’s 1 Delaware Valley broke open a close game with relentless offense, pulling away for a 23–1 victory over King’s (Pa.). King’s struck first in the opening inning on an RBI single from Wanamaker, but Delaware Valley answered immediately. Nathan Fisher delivered an RBI single in the bottom half to tie the game at 1–1.
